Danger Mouse tops CBBC ratings

Best performing new kids’ show of 2015, according to new BARB figures.

The new-look Danger Mouse is the best performing new kids’ show of the year, according to industry ratings body BARB.

The data is for children aged six to 12 and four to 15, and is based on average figures for the first 15 episodes.

In addition, the show – which is aired on CBBC – is the number one in its time slot for boys aged four to nine (across all channels) and is also number one for four to 15 year olds (among dedicated children’s channels).

The new show began airing on September 28, and so far, a total of 2.4 million people have seen Danger Mouse on TV during the first three weeks of the run. It also has over two million views on the BBC’s iPlayer catch up service.

The total audience (including adult fans) grew by 11% between weeks one and three. The increase is even higher for four to 15 year olds, amounting to 14% in the same timeframe. The rise for the six to 12 audience is also 14%.

“We are absolutely thrilled with these ratings,” said Rick Glankler, evp and general manager at FremantleMedia Kids & Family Entertainment.

“We anticipated from our initial early screenings that the public were going to like the show, so we are delighted to learn that Danger Mouse is entertaining millions of children and their parents across the country.”
